Lakeside physician achieves Board certification
LAKEPORT – Lakeside Health Center announces that one of its full-time staff physicians, Dr. Bruce Barnett, was recently awarded certification by the American Board of Family Medicine (ABFM). The ABFM certification is provided upon successful completion of a written examination that tests knowledge and problem-solving abilities in the fields of adult medicine, newborn, infant, child and adolescent care, maternity and gynecological care, community medicine, care of the older patient, human behavior, mental health and care for the surgical patient.
Dr. Barnett is a graduate of Harvard Medical School. He completed his Family Medicine residency at the University of Southern California Keck School of Medicine. He joined Lakeside Health Center clinical staff in July, 2006.
Lakeside Health Center is operated by the local, nonprofit Mendocino Community Health Clinic, Inc. (MCHC). MCHC’s mission is to provide quality health services to the most vulnerable in our community. The MCHC Board of Directors recognizes board certification as one of the many indicators of high quality medical care. All health care providers at MCHC are strongly encouraged to maintain current applicable certifications from respective specialty organizations. MCHC has congratulates Dr. Barnett for his contribution to the quality of healthcare in the greater Lakeport community.
